Ate at Big O's on Monday while down there on vacation. Small place and it was pretty good for a light meal. I had a soft shell crab po-boy. They supposedly have a pretty good breakfast also.

Nolan's for steaks.
Mikee's for seafood.
Cafe Grazie in OB for Italian Seafood. They have a roasted garlic bread service that is amazing.
Rotolo's for pizza (seriously-there is nothing in the area for pizza).
Cozmo's in OB is the best restaurant in the area, but there is always an hr and a half wait.
No good mexican (go figure).
